BITHYNIA, Flaviopolis (as Cretaia). Julia Domna. Augusta, AD 193-217. Æ (27mm, 10.67 g, 6h). IOVΛIA ΔOMNA CЄ, draped bust right / KPHTIЄΩN ΦΛ A OVIOΠΟΛΙ, Demeter standing left, holding grain ears and scepter. Corsten –; cf. RG 7 (for rev.; Pius); SNG von Aulock –; SNG Copenhagen –; BMC –; cf. M&M GmbH 15, lot 300 (same obv. die); otherwise unpublished. VF, green and brown surfaces, some pitting. Apparently unique.
